Spaced review
Use this method as an active task rather than another passage to skim. Return to important concepts after a delay. Separating repetitions makes memory work harder and helps reveal which ideas are retained rather than merely recognized. Finish by stating the concept in two clear sentences. If the explanation remains vague, narrow the topic and review the underlying distinction again. This keeps self-paced study purposeful.
Ask why
A practical approach is to attempt the task without notes before checking the source. Attach a brief explanation to important facts. Understanding why a distinction matters creates more retrieval cues than memorizing isolated wording. After the first attempt, identify one missing or inaccurate detail and correct only that point. Return later and try again without looking at the correction. The learner should be able to identify what improved and what remains unresolved.

Build a personal retrieval deck
For learners using this Lucerne page, Create a small set of prompts from concepts that actually required effort. Keep answers brief, shuffle the prompts, and retire cards that become consistently easy. A smaller deck of meaningful weaknesses is more useful than hundreds of copied facts. Create a correction loop
For learners using this Lucerne page, For every incorrect practice response, make an immediate correction, explain why the original answer failed, and schedule one delayed retry. The delayed retry is the important part because it tests whether feedback became retrievable knowledge.
